概括
研究人员开发了一种新的多孔聚合物,用于有效的光催化二氧化碳减排. 用TCNQ进行兴奋剂增强了光吸收和催化活性,显著增加了可再生能源应用的CO产量.

主要成果:
- 被杂的CMP (TCNQ@TAPFc-TFPPy-CMP) 显示了减少的光学带隙 (1.43 eV).
- 在二氧化碳减排方面实现了高碳产量 (546.8 μmol g-1 h-1) 和选择性 (96%).
- 与未使用CMP相比,CO产量增加了80%.

The Calvin Benson Cycle
Ribulose 1,5- bisphosphate carboxylase/oxygenase (RuBisCo) is a critical enzyme that catalyzes carbon dioxide assimilation during photosynthesis. However, it is an inefficient enzyme, having an extremely slow catalytic rate. A typical enzyme can process about a thousand molecules per second; however, RuBisCo fixes only around three-carbon dioxides per second. Preparation of Amines: Reductive Amination of Aldehydes and Ketones
Carbonyl compounds and primary amines undergo reductive amination first to produce imines, followed by secondary amines in the same reaction mixture, using selective reducing agents like sodium cyanoborohydride or sodium triacetoxyborohydride. Reductive amination produces different degrees of substitution of amines depending on the starting amine substrate.
Phase I Reactions: Reductive Reactions
Phase I biotransformation reductive reactions are chemical processes that modify drugs by introducing or revealing polar functional groups via reduction. Enzymes called reductases catalyze these reactions, playing a pivotal role in drug metabolism by transforming lipophilic drugs into more polar, water-soluble metabolites for easy excretion.
